Artist: Codeseven

 
"Starboard" by Codeseven explores themes of vulnerability, connection, and the cyclical nature of personal growth and setbacks. The song utilizes maritime imagery to convey feelings of being lost, seeking guidance, and the tumultuous journey of self-improvement and relationships. The opening lines, "Throw me out and reel me in / You know I've been a fool," suggest a relationship dynamic where one party is asking for patience and forgiveness, acknowledging their mistakes and the other's role in helping them navigate through their errors. The imagery of being thrown out and reeled in like a fish speaks to the idea of making mistakes, drifting away, and then being brought back to safety or stability by someone caring. "Tear the line that stretches out / That runs from me to you" could symbolize the desire to break free from patterns or behaviors that strain a relationship, with the "line" representing both the connection between individuals and the barriers or expectations that may separate them. The refrain, "Don't give up on me / I'll do just what you say," is a plea for another chance and a commitment to change, showing a willingness to listen and adapt for the sake of the relationship. The "star that shines / Only for you" is a poignant metaphor for personal dedication and the unique light one may hold for someone special, emphasizing the song's theme of deep, personal connection. The use of waves and the riptide as metaphors for the forces that push and pull, both within the self and in relationships, highlights the natural ebb and flow of emotional states and the external pressures that can lead one to drift away from their intended path or from those they care about. The imagery of being "Washed up on the beach / The stars are little grains" evokes a sense of insignificance and loss, perhaps suggesting moments of feeling small or overwhelmed by life's vastness and the forces beyond one's control. "Starboard," in its essence, captures the struggle between the desire for independence and the need for connection, the process of acknowledging one's flaws while striving for improvement, and the hope that someone will remain steadfast, offering guidance and forgiveness as one navigates the tumultuous seas of life. The song's rich maritime imagery serves as a backdrop for exploring these deeply human experiences, making it relatable to anyone who has felt adrift and in search of direction.
